I am currently handling a project of this kind and may be able to share some info (which i cannot post on this forum). u may want to google some info on soap-making, that will be a good start. also consider what kind of production u want to achieve - top quality, medium quality or low basic quality; how much do u want to produce and at what rate - daily, weekly or monthly; do u want to start-up in ur home or purchase a production plant; what unique quality will ur soap possess to compete in the market? it is not an easy start-up though, this enterprise; i must warn u. so brace yourself and start to research aggressively if u want to develop ur interest. Hi Babyjay,
 I make and sell soap as a side gig. I specialize in soap for drier skin types and sensitive skins. I 've been doing this for about 2and half years now.
You can build a successful business doing it from home, you don't need any major investment in equipment,
In europe you have to have certification for your products and so it is important  to do your research, I don't know if this is also the case in Nig, but even if not, you want to be careful that what you're selling is safe.
 Luckily for you, raw materials/ingredients are at your  disposal in Nig so you 'll have one major hurdle crossed.
As eol has suggested, research reseach and some more before you put your soap on the market. The soapdish forum is an excellent resource but be sure to use the search feature before posting queries else you could get flamed! Wink

baby Jay. Good that you have this zeal. I have worked on the project before. I still have the research on the diskette. i went as far as possible in getting company that can fabicated needed machine. Talk to Engr. Akinfewa @ techno-Equip. I can really remeber the adress now, but i know it is at Ejigbo or thereabout. There can offer you machine on installmental payment. But I will advise you start from home test running whatever fomula you have for your soap. Also work well on your marketing strategy. If you would mind try seeing the MD of DUDU OSUN at TOPASS Plaza Agidingbi Road, Ikeja. He will be of great help to you cause you will need a mentor to really break through.
